I have passed by the Lipstick building a hundred times over the years and watched as this new coffee/food spot was developed in the vast lobby area. Last week I decided to try it out and stopped in for a coffee. Nice clean and quiet space with a steady stream of customers, most for take out. The coffee was very good. The seating area is a little sterile for me but still pleasant. - THE EXPLORER

Location and Accessibility

Épicerie Boulud is strategically located at 885 3rd Ave, New York, NY 10022, situated inside the lobby of the famous Lipstick Building. For those navigating the New York region, accessibility is one of the primary draws of this specific location. It sits directly at the intersection of 53rd Street and 3rd Avenue, a critical junction for Midtown East commerce and transit. Its proximity to major public transportation makes it an ideal stop for those on the move. The bakery is located right by the 53rd St and 3rd Ave subway entrance, providing immediate access to the E and M trains, and it is only a short walk from the 6 train at the 51st Street station.

The layout of the space within the building lobby allows for a seamless transition from the sidewalk to the counter. For local office workers, the location is a convenient "grab-and-go" hub during the morning rush or the lunch hour. Furthermore, the surrounding area is a mix of high-end corporate offices and residential buildings, making it a versatile spot that serves different needs throughout the day. While the seating area is often described as having a modern and slightly "sterile" aesthetic—fitting for a corporate landmark lobby—it remains a pleasant and professional environment for a quick sit-down meeting or a solo coffee break. The large open area ensures that even during peak hours, the space feels breathable and organized, a luxury in the densely packed grid of Midtown Manhattan.
